Investigation of Metal to Dielectric Waveguide Transition and the Coupling Characteristics of Dielectric Waveguides of Rectangular Cross Section.

Abstract

The development of an efficient low-loss transition from a conventional metal waveguide to a planar dielectric guide of rectangular cross-section is presented. Such a transition finds important applications in millimeter-wave integrated circuits. We also present an approximate but accurate analytical method based on experimental results for predicting the coupling characteristics of both symmetrical and nonsymmetrical dielectric couplers of rectangular cross-section.
